public class BeanObjectTypeInfo extends ObjectTypeInfo
DynamicBeanInfo
,
Serialized FormModifier and Type | Field and Description |
---|---|
static java.lang.String |
CLASS_VERSION
Class version string
|
Constructor and Description |
---|
BeanObjectTypeInfo(java.lang.Class pClass,
DynamicBeanInfo pBeanInfo,
DynamicPropertyDescriptor pPropertyDescriptor)
Constructs a BeanObjectTypeInfo from a class and a DynamicBeanInfo
|
BeanObjectTypeInfo(DynamicBeanInfo pBeanInfo)
Constructs a BeanObjectTypeInfo from a DynamicBeanInfo
|
Modifier and Type | Method and Description |
---|---|
DynamicBeanInfo |
getBeanInfo()
Returns the BeanInfo for this object.
|
java.lang.Class |
getClassInfo() |
ObjectTypeInfo |
getComponentInfo() |
DynamicPropertyDescriptor |
getPropertyDescriptor() |
boolean |
isArray() |
toString
public BeanObjectTypeInfo(java.lang.Class pClass, DynamicBeanInfo pBeanInfo, DynamicPropertyDescriptor pPropertyDescriptor)
public BeanObjectTypeInfo(DynamicBeanInfo pBeanInfo)
public DynamicBeanInfo getBeanInfo()
getBeanInfo
in class ObjectTypeInfo
public boolean isArray()
isArray
in class ObjectTypeInfo
public ObjectTypeInfo getComponentInfo()
getComponentInfo
in class ObjectTypeInfo
public java.lang.Class getClassInfo()
getClassInfo
in class ObjectTypeInfo
public DynamicPropertyDescriptor getPropertyDescriptor()
getPropertyDescriptor
in class ObjectTypeInfo